Pain Management Group is currently seeking a Clinical Support Specialist to join their team in Michigan. The Clinical Support Specialist is responsible for the initial and ongoing training and development of PMG’s partner clinical staff teams on pain management clinic operations, quality, safety and protocol. This position will focus on PMG partnerships in Michigan to provide routine and as needed support, training and guidance on clinical standards, and integrate best practices to ensure high quality care and process execution within outpatient pain management.

About Us: Pain Management Group (PMG) partners with hospitals to manage socially and medically responsible pain management centers that deliver outstanding clinical care with quantifiable outcomes. Through PMG’s model of clinical accountability and integrated team process, PMG partner hospitals and contracted providers strengthen their communities by offering safe and responsible pain treatment and helps patients dealing with chronic pain regain function for their daily life activities using multiple modalities of care.
